Mother arrested after hungry preschoolers go out by themselves in the middle of the night to “go to Starbucks for a cake pop”

BY JENNIFER CABRERA

Chrissa Kenta Taylor, 29, was arrested yesterday after her 4- and 5-year-old sons were found several blocks from their home in the middle of the night. The children said they were hungry and looking for food.

According to the arrest report, a 911 call was received at 4:45 a.m. on May 10 to report that two children were wandering in the 1700 block of NW 13th Street without any supervision. Gainesville Police Department officers located the children and determined that they were ages 4 and 5. The children were wearing only boxers, and the temperature was in the 50s.

Investigators determined that the children lived in an apartment near the intersection of 13th Street and 16th Avenue and that they had walked down two flights of stairs and traveled two blocks before the 911 call. Taylor was identified as the mother of the children.

The children reportedly told officers that they left their home because they were hungry and looking for food.

Officers contacted their mother at 7:45 a.m., and she was reportedly unaware that her children had been missing for nearly 4 hours.

The children underwent a forensic interview and medical evaluation. One child reportedly said that he is hungry at home, but there is no food there; he also said that when they try to wake up their mom, she “gets mad and yells.” The other child reportedly said their mother has no money for food and that they left to go to Starbucks for a cake pop. He said they tried to wake up their mother, but she did not get up.

A medical exam reportedly found that both children are underweight; the reports on both children said they were “extremely skinny” and that their “bones are visible” through the skin.

The children also reportedly said they stay awake all night and sleep all day; they said they play on their tablets and watch TV and YouTube all the time. They reportedly said they are often left alone, without any supervision.

The investigation also found that a third child, a 13-year-old boy, is also present in the home; the investigation found that he has not been enrolled in school since March 2022 and plays video games all day.

Post Miranda, Taylor reportedly said she was asleep when the children left, that she didn’t know they had left, and that she didn’t have any money to buy food. She showed officers that her food stamp card had just reloaded on May 10 and reportedly said she had planned to buy food that day. She also reportedly said that she had pulled the 13-year-old from school because he was supposed to go to another state with his grandmother, but they don’t have a reliable car to get him there.

Taylor has been charged with two counts of child neglect without great bodily harm and has been released from the jail.
